Templates should register the statistic providers they need

Currently, a fixed set of statistic types is generated by StatGen. However, not all these statistics are interesting for every template. It would be better if the templates could register what types of statistics they need before starting the stats generation.

Add "auto" mode that filters commits heuristically

Large repositories, like the Linux kernel, often contain commits with bogus commit date (e.g., 1970-01-01 01:00:01 +0100, 2085-06-18 15:57:19 +0000, ...). At the moment these commits can be omitted using the --no-future and --max-age=<days> arguments. However, having an (opt-in) "automatic" mode would be nice.

Configurable limits and precision

Having more control over the limits, that are currently hard coded in the ParamsHelper, as well as the precision of the displayed data would make gitstats-rb more useful for large repositories.

Having a knob to switch to weekly precision instead of daily (for the global activity as well as the authors) would, for example, permit to show far more history in repositories like the Linux kernel.
